![]() Instead, he relies on the goodwill of other law enforcement departments, a situation that he has never been happy with. No longer can he pick up the phone and find out from a snitch where the killers may be. The difference here is that the scale is larger, and Davenport must find his feet in this new environment. Golden Prey has all the ingredients that makes a great Prey novel, a dastardly crime, unlikable killers and the most important thing, the chase. Can Davenport bring his maverick skills to the big scene and chase the killer and his cohort across the country? He must get to them first before the wronged drug lord does. He may just be in luck as a former FBI Most Wanted criminal has come back on the scene after a shootout between criminals leaves several dead, including an innocent young girl. The politics bores him, and all that Davenport wants in the chase. However, losing his local networks has left him feeling like a limb is missing. Moving up to the big leagues sounded like a great idea to Davenport when he was encouraged to do so by his friend, who also happens to be the favourite to be the next President of the United States. ![]() He is no longer just Minneapolis' greatest, but America's, as Davenport is now a fully-fledged US Marshal. How do you keep a series fresh? In the case of Davenport, the books have had a shakeup. With a long running series comes experience but also the threat of stagnation. ![]() John Sandford's Lucas Davenport books must be a success when you realise that Golden Prey is the 27th book centred on the character. The long running series is a dream for an author as it means that your characters and world are successful enough that people are buying them, and you can keep writing. ![]()
